Crucial Tips for DnB Music Production
To create a place in the colorful world of drum and bass, paying attention to audio design is critical. Start by experimenting with various synthesizers and samples to produce original basslines that will distinguish your tracks different. Utilize techniques like stacking multiple sounds and using modulation to give your bass a fuller presence. Additionally, explore using effects such as overdrive and filtering to improve the texture of your sounds, causing them be prominent in the mix.

When it comes to creating beats, the key is to achieve the right beat and punch. Begin with a reliable kick and snare combination that provides a firm foundation. Layering kicks and adding ghost notes can provide dimension to your beats. Be willing to change velocities to create a more dynamic groove. The swing of your hi-hats and percussion can also significantly impact the overall feel, so test until you achieve the right balance that keeps energy throughout the track.
